Cult of the brand
Certain corporate HQs can sometimes remind you of places of worship. The Zen-like Nike European headquarters in Hilversum is one such place. Instead of crosses we find ticks everywhere and instead of monks and priests we find the employees of Nike. Apparently, they genuinely get annoyed if they see that you’re wearing Adidas. A glib observation?
The management consultant, August Turak recently spent 6 months living with trappist monks and discovered these 7 organisational principles.
#1 – Having a high overarching mission worthy of being served.
#2 – Selflessness; dedicated pursuit of a noble, well-articulated, mission.
#3 – Commitment to excellence.
#4 – A ruthless dedication to the highest ethical standards.
#5 – Faith; through boom and economic bust.
#6 – Trust; deployed throughout the organization.
#7 – Living the life; a rigorous methodology of reinforcement.
Not sure whether this applies to Nike’s business but it seems like a pretty good way of getting people to believe in your business nevertheless.
